[slackware-security] bind (SSA:2015-349-01)

New bind packages are available for Slackware 13.0, 13.1, 13.37, 14.0, 14.1,
and -current to fix security issues.


Here are the details from the Slackware 14.1 ChangeLog:
+--------------------------+
patches/packages/bind-9.9.8_P2-x86_64-1_slack14.1.txz: Upgraded.
This update fixes three security issues:
Update allowed OpenSSL versions as named is potentially vulnerable
to CVE-2015-3193.
Insufficient testing when parsing a message allowed records with an
incorrect class to be be accepted, triggering a REQUIRE failure when
those records were subsequently cached. (CVE-2015-8000)
Address fetch context reference count handling error on socket error.
(CVE-2015-8461)

Installation instructions:
+------------------------+

Upgrade the package as root:
# upgradepkg bind-9.9.8_P2-i486-1_slack14.1.txz

Then, restart the name server:

# /etc/rc.d/rc.bind restart
